Episode 179 - Leo Bottary discusses his book What Anyone Can Do and how surrounding yourself with the right people will drive change, opportunity and personal growth. Leo is an instructor for both Rutgers and Northeastern Universities. Prior to that, he was an adjunct professor for Seton Hall University, where he was named adjunct teacher of the year.
